# Release Strategy ## Semantic Versioning - **MAJOR** — breaking API/schema/contract changes - **MINOR** — backward-compatible features / modules - **PATCH** — fixes, docs, non-breaking hardening ## Release Notes Each release documents: - Features - Fixes - Migrations required - Config/env changes - Provider changes - Deprecations ## Migration Order 1. Backup ([backup.md](../deployment/backup.md)) 2. Apply migrations **per service** in dependency order (typically Core → Identity → business services) 3. Deploy services compatible with the new schema 4. Smoke-test health and critical auth/onboarding paths 5. Only then enable new feature flags ## Rollback 1. Prefer forward-fix migrations when possible 2. Application rollback to previous image/tag 3. Database downgrade only with tested Alembic downgrade path and restore point 4. Document incident in progress / ops notes ## Feature Flags Use config/env or plan entitlements to gate incomplete modules. Do not ship half-enabled financial posting paths. ## Related Documents - [Branching Strategy](branching-strategy.md) - [Deployment](../deployment/deployment.md) - [Disaster Recovery](../deployment/disaster-recovery.md)
